Republic Operations H-1B salaries (2025)

Yes — Republic Operations sponsors H-1B workers. Across 7 certified Labor Condition Applications, the median offered base wage is $106,433. Every figure below comes straight from the employer's own filings with the U.S. Department of Labor.

Wage-level distribution

DOL prevailing-wage levels reflect the seniority the employer certified, from Level I (entry) to Level IV (fully competent).

Source: U.S. Department of Labor OFLC certified Labor Condition Applications (H-1B, H-1B1, E-3), public disclosure data. Wages are employer-offered base pay and exclude bonuses, equity, and other compensation. Denied and withdrawn filings are excluded. Figures reflect filings decided Dec 2024Aug 2025.
